Genes affected
KRT23 (HGNC:6438): (keratin 23) The protein encoded by this gene is a member of the keratin family. The keratins are intermediate filament proteins responsible for the structural integrity of epithelial cells and are subdivided into cytokeratins and hair keratins. The type I cytokeratins consist of acidic proteins which are arranged in pairs of heterotypic keratin chains. The type I cytokeratin genes are clustered in a region of chromosome 17q12-q21.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Sep 2013]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 24, 2023The c.779A>G (p.D260G) alteration is located in exon 5 (coding exon 4) of the KRT23 gene. This alteration results from a A to G substitution at nucleotide position 779, causing the aspartic acid (D) at amino acid position 260 to be replaced by a glycine (G).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
